[Hospital costs estimation by micro and gross-costing approaches]
P Guerre1, N Hayes2, A-C Bertaux3
1Service d'évaluation économique en santé, Direction de la recherche clinique et de l'innovation (DRCI), Service d'évaluation économique en santé, hospices civils de Lyon, 3, quai des Célestins, 69002 Lyon, France.
Understanding hospital costs requires choosing the right perspective and costing method. This study details micro-costing and gross-costing methods, aiding healthcare facilities in accurate financial analysis and resource allocation.
Area of Science:
- Health Economics
- Hospital Management
- Healthcare Finance
Background:
- Cost analysis is crucial in healthcare facilities.
- Selecting the appropriate perspective (e.g., facility vs. public health insurance) is a primary consideration.
- Various costing methods exist, with micro-costing and gross-costing being prevalent in France.
Purpose of the Study:
- To describe micro-costing and gross-costing methods, including data collection and valuation.
- To review literature comparing these methods and their potential combinations.
- To propose a framework for data compilation and cost assignment in hospitals.
Main Methods:
- Descriptive analysis of micro-costing and gross-costing.
- Literature review of comparative studies.
- Development of a decision-making framework for hospital costing.
Main Results:
- Detailed advantages and disadvantages of each costing method.
- Insights into implementation challenges within hospitals.
- Identification of optimal methodologies based on evaluation strategy and patient care impact.
Conclusions:
- The choice of costing perspective and method significantly impacts financial analysis.
- A structured approach is needed to select the most appropriate costing methodology.
- The study provides guidance for accurate hospital cost determination and resource management.
